Common Garage Door Repair Scams in Oakfield

Be aware of these tactic used by unlicensed operators

🚫

Fake Emergency Spring Replacement

Scammer alarms you that garage door springs are about to break, insisting on immediate expensive replacement.

🚫

Bait-and-Switch Pricing

Low phone quote turns into much higher on-site bill after 'discovering' extra issues.

🚫

Unnecessary Parts Upsell

Recommends replacing functional parts like openers or panels to inflate the bill.

🚫

Phantom Damage Repair

Claims hidden damage requiring full door replacement when minor fix suffices.

How to Verify a Professional

1

Insurance

Ask for a certificate of insurance (COI) showing general liability coverage. Call the insurer to verify it's current and lists you as additional insured.

2

Licensing

Search the Tennessee Board for Licensing Contractors database at tn.gov/commerce. Enter the company name or license number. Confirm any Madison County business licenses via the county clerk.

3

References

Request at least 3 recent references from Oakfield or Madison County customers. Call them to ask about work quality, timeliness, and cleanup.

Protection FAQs

How do I verify a garage door repair license in Tennessee?

Use the TN Department of Commerce & Insurance lookup tool at tn.gov. Search by business name or license number for active status.

Should I pay upfront for garage door repairs?

No—legit pros take small deposits after contract signing, balance on completion. Avoid full upfront cash payments.

What insurance does a garage door pro need?

General liability (at least $1M) and workers' comp. Get COI and verify directly with insurer.

Are door-to-door garage door repair offers legitimate?

Rarely. Trustworthy services come via referrals, websites, or matching platforms—not cold calls.

Do garage door repairs require permits in Madison County?

Check with Madison County Building Department. Major repairs or replacements often need permits.

How can I get safe quotes for garage door service in Oakfield?

Contact verified professionals for written quotes. Compare 3+ from licensed, insured locals.

What if a pro pressures me to hire on the spot?

Walk away. Real experts give time to review estimates and references.
